Postby williamconley » Thu Jan 27, 2011 8:48 am

instead of copying files from one machine to the other, activate install.pl from the machine you are on. that way the files will all match the presently installed version properly.

if necessary, use svn to get all your files and even consider an upgrade to the latest while you are at it.

I almost got the new webserver running, but there are some things that irritated me. Since I had to move a vicidialNOW-webserver to a vicibox-webserver I thought most settings should be of the same. But they weren't. Maybe because the install-script did not work for me. I give you some settings that were differently configured on both servers and I'd like to know why ...

On VicidialNOW:
MaxClients 256
ServerLimit 256

On Vicibox:
MaxClients 150
ServerLimit 150

It took a while to find out why some agents could log in whereas others later on could not, because the page was not loaded ... now, after reading something about Apache's MPM modules, I understand more, but I don't get the sense, why these two settings are by default so low on viciboxes.

got it ..

Postby ronator » Mon Feb 07, 2011 7:19 am

ok:
/etc/cron.daily calls logrotate; logrotate.conf includes /etc/logrotate.d
/etc/cron.daily is called by /etc/crontab which itself calls run-parts
run-parts calls /usr/lib/cron/run-crons which is like
Code: Select all
-*/15 * * * *   root  test -x /usr/lib/cron/run-crons && /usr/lib/cron/run-crons >/dev/null 2>&1

Solution: I set the variable "DAILY_TIME" in /etc/sysconfig/cron to a value that makes much more sense to me.
Notice: As far as I understood, run-parts refers to the server-start time; so it always tries to re-run the scripts at the same given time.
I think with the variable set in /etc/sysconfig/cron I have a working solution, but actually I'll see that tomorrow.
